首页 > 编程语言
python+selenium怎么获取ul下面最后一个li或ul中有多少个li
如何获取出ul中最后一个li或者是获取出ul中有多少个li;如何获取出页面中某class存在多少个from selenium import webdriver chrome = webdriver.Chrome() chrome.get('https://www.bilibili.com') ul ...
分类:编程语言   时间:2021-04-13 00:47:53    收藏:0  评论:0  赞:0  阅读:135
Java利用jmatio读取.mat文件中的多维矩阵
Jmatio包只提供了二维数组的读取,对于多维数组,需要自己编写代码手动进行组装。需要注意的是,Jmatio在读取.mat文件中的数据时,是按照低维读向高维数据的顺序来构建字节流,而不是我们平常的先读取最高维度的数据,再依次读取低维数据。 注意,如果先从低维开始读,那么构建出来的数组数据会与.mat ...
分类:编程语言   时间:2021-04-13 00:46:22    收藏:0  评论:0  赞:0  阅读:43
python 基础之单例模式
什么是单例模式?单例模式是指类生成对象时,只能生成一个实例,其实这里的只能生成一个实例指的是只会分配一个内存地址用于此类的实例生成,所有实例化的对象,最终都是返回的改地址所指向的对象。 我们来看一个单例的例子: class Students: __singleStudent = None def _ ...
分类:编程语言   时间:2021-04-13 00:46:10    收藏:0  评论:0  赞:0  阅读:53
【C语言基础】初始C语言(一)
C语言是一门通用计算机编程语言,广泛应用于底层开发。语言的发展:(由低级语言向高级语言的发展)二进制语言(硬件-电:正电(1)/负电(0)(低级)汇编(助记符)B语言C语言、C++、JAVA(高级)C语言发展(早期不成熟à成熟à流行)C语言国际标准(ANSIC–C89/C90C99/C11并不流行,不少编译器不支持)
分类:编程语言   时间:2021-04-13 00:45:39    收藏:0  评论:0  赞:0  阅读:41
java多线程学习二:如何创建线程以及线程的常用方法
java多线程学习二:如何创建线程以及线程的常用方法 1.线程的创建方法 1.1继承Thread类,然后重写run()方法。 public class CreadThread1 { //继承Thread类 public static class aThread extends Thread{ @Ov ...
分类:编程语言   时间:2021-04-13 00:45:10    收藏:0  评论:0  赞:0  阅读:52
JavaSE基础——面向对象1:类与对象005
JavaSE基础——面向对象1:类与对象 一、编程思想 一般来说,计算机语言要处理的就两个方面的内容:数据和算法。数据是程序使用和处理的信息;算法是程序使用的方法。 1.面向过程编程(POP, Procedure Oriented Programming) 核心思想:分析出解决问题所需要的步骤,然后 ...
分类:编程语言   时间:2021-04-12 22:51:17    收藏:0  评论:0  赞:0  阅读:59
【Python】定义类、创建类实例
>>> class TestClass:... def __init__(self,name,gender):... self.Name=name... self.Gender=gender... print("hello")...>>> test=TestClass('Lee','Man')hel ...
分类:编程语言   时间:2021-04-12 22:50:35    收藏:0  评论:0  赞:0  阅读:66
创建线程的方式三:实现Callable接口 --- JDK 5.0新增
/** * 创建线程的方式三:实现Callable接口。 JDK 5.0新增 * * * 如何理解实现Callable接口的方式创建多线程比实现Runnable接口创建多线程方式强大? * 1. call()可以有返回值的。 * 2. call()可以抛出异常,被外面的操作捕获,获取异常的信息 * ...
分类:编程语言   时间:2021-04-12 22:49:29    收藏:0  评论:0  赞:0  阅读:57
C#语法基础10_枚举enum
C#语法基础10_枚举enum 定义 名称首字母大写,定义在类下 enum Name { listelementone,listelementtwo,listelementthree,... } 调用 enum Name { listelementone,listelementtwo,listele ...
分类:编程语言   时间:2021-04-12 22:49:16    收藏:0  评论:0  赞:0  阅读:52
直接插入排序算法
直接插入排序是一种简单直观的排序方法,它的基本操作是将一个元素插入到已经排好序的有序序列中,从而得到一个新的,记录数增1的有序序列,工作原理类似我们抓扑克牌。 执行过程 对一组序列42,11,27,13,47,28,1,4,48,44执行直接插入排序算法,其排序过程如下: 代码 直接插入排序的C++ ...
分类:编程语言   时间:2021-04-12 22:48:12    收藏:0  评论:0  赞:0  阅读:40
Java-NIO、BIO、AIO
JAVA-NIO、BIO、AIO 本次知识点基于黑马课程IO模式讲解 零:同步、异步、阻塞和非阻塞 1.同步 例:买饭:自己亲自去饭馆买饭,这就是同步(自己处理IO读写) 2.异步 例:买饭:叫外卖送到家,这就是异步(IO读写委托给OS处理,需要将数据缓冲区地址和大小传给OS(饭名和地址),OS需要 ...
分类:编程语言   时间:2021-04-12 22:47:18    收藏:0  评论:0  赞:0  阅读:37
最小生成树(C语言, kruskal算法)
本代码不能直接运行,只是阐述对该算法的理解/**kruskal算法,边集数组,无向图,最小生成树,贪心算法*代码实现<<大话数据结构>>图7-6-7(和prim算法用的同一张图)*最终成生n-1条边的树,路径权值和最小*///边集数组的节点typedefstruct{intbegin;intend;intweight;}NODE,*PNODE;//此函数的功能是根据pare
分类:编程语言   时间:2021-04-12 22:44:36    收藏:0  评论:0  赞:0  阅读:41
为什么用线程池?解释下线程池参数
为什么用线程池?解释下线程池参数 1 、降低资源消耗;提高线程利用率,降低创建和销毁线程的消耗。 2 、提高响应速度;任务来了,直接有线程可以使用,而不是先创建,在执行。 3 、 提高线程的可管理性;线程是稀缺资源,使用线程池可以统一分配调优监控。 1)corePoolSize 代表的最大线程数,也 ...
分类:编程语言   时间:2021-04-12 22:42:08    收藏:0  评论:0  赞:0  阅读:50
threading.Thread 子线程强制停止
import time import random import threading class MyThread(threading.Thread): def __init__( self, group=None, target=None, name=None, args=(), kwargs=N ...
分类:编程语言   时间:2021-04-12 22:41:36    收藏:0  评论:0  赞:0  阅读:35
JavaSE基础——数组004
JavaSE基础——数组 一、初识数组 1. 什么是数组? 前面在学习Java数据类型的时候曾经谈到,Java的数据类型分为基本类型和引用类型。基本类型包括整型、浮点型、字符类型、布尔类型四种。引用类型包括类、接口、数组等。 数组对于每一门编程语言来说都是重要的数据结构之一,当然不同语言对数组的实现 ...
分类:编程语言   时间:2021-04-12 22:36:02    收藏:0  评论:0  赞:0  阅读:40
Spring boot静态资源过滤
Spring boot Web支持两类静态资源路径: 1、urlPatterns:"/webjars/**",对应静态资源路径为:"classpath:/META-INF/resources/webjars/" 2、urlPatterns:"/**",对应静态资源路径为: classpath:/ME ...
分类:编程语言   时间:2021-04-12 22:33:43    收藏:0  评论:0  赞:0  阅读:41
java集合-数组ArrayList
1、简介 ArrayList是java集合框架常用的集合类之一,底层是基于数组来实现容量大小动态变化的。 2、类图(JDK 1.8) 下图是ArrayList实现的接口和继承的类关系图: public class ArrayList<E> extends AbstractList<E> implem ...
分类:编程语言   时间:2021-04-12 22:32:38    收藏:0  评论:0  赞:0  阅读:27
python GUI+pycharm打包工程为exe文件
一、准本工作 系统:win10 开发环境:pycharm 三方库:pyqt5、pyqt5-tools python版本:v3.7.3 pip版本:v20.3.1 二、三方库安装 命令行(cmd)输入:【pip list】查看安装的三方库信息,【pip install PyQt5】进行pyqt5组件下 ...
分类:编程语言   时间:2021-04-12 22:29:15    收藏:0  评论:0  赞:0  阅读:51
ADA 95教程 高级特性 高级数组主题
Example program > e_c19_p1.ada -- Chapter 19 - Program 1 with Ada.Text_IO, Ada.Integer_Text_IO; use Ada.Text_IO, Ada.Integer_Text_IO; procedure Summer ...
分类:编程语言   时间:2021-04-12 22:27:43    收藏:0  评论:0  赞:0  阅读:30
C语言结构类型(mooc)
枚举:枚举值的类型一定是int,没有其他类型。从0开始,依次递增。 有一个小套路: enum COLOR {red, green, blue, purple, numCOLORS}; // 因为枚举值是从0开始依次递增,所以最后一个值是和前面的个数相等的。比如前面有4个值,而numCOLORS也是4 ...
分类:编程语言   时间:2021-04-12 22:26:14    收藏:0  评论:0  赞:0  阅读:34
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!